Arrived my new explorer II
Hi everyone. Felt like sharing a photo of my new watch. For me it feels as my first serious collectible watch even though I have owned vintage subs and GMT:s in the past. Mainly because it is in really nice original condition. Dare I say it. The case looks like it could be unpolished but I'll leave that for the experts to comment.
This is for me the best condition to enjoy vintage watches. You can see it has seen the world and has some memories from the explorations of the previous owner but still has the proportions that it had when it left the factory. Also as I plan to use it everyday this is great. If the watch would be nos example I wouldn't dare to use it. I caught the vintage rolex bug something like two years ago and have since flipped 16 watches (this is starting to hear like an AA meeting). This is the first time I don't feel theres any need for that since the explorer is personal enough. For the watch geek it tells that I know my watches and for the rest it flies nicely under the radar. Now its time to take a little break from the watch world. Maybe I'll return to the hunt if I have some significant achievement in my life but don't really feel need for it. ![]() One idea I have toyed with in my mind is to take the watch to ABC and have them repaint the orange hand. But I'm sure everybody here is against that. :) |

There's some awesome patina in that there watch.
By the way, has it ever bothered anyone else that the 1655 is routinely described as being 40mm across, when it's really 38-39mm? Definitely smaller than a 5513 or 1680.

Veddy nice! Looks like a MK4 dial with MK3 bezel. Don't you dare paint the 24H hand!!! Which, per the Explorer booklets back, were actually red.......
